首页
学习
活动
专区
工具
TVP
发布
技术百科首页 >数据访问控制 >如何为不同类型的用户和应用程序实现细粒度的数据访问控制?

如何为不同类型的用户和应用程序实现细粒度的数据访问控制?

词条归属:数据访问控制

为不同类型的用户和应用程序实现细粒度的数据访问控制,可以采用以下几种方法:

基于角色的访问控制(RBAC)

将用户分配到不同的角色中,每个角色具有一定的权限,从而控制用户的数据访问权限。通过定义不同的角色和权限,可以为不同类型的用户和应用程序实现细粒度的数据访问控制。

基于属性的访问控制(ABAC)

根据用户的属性(如所在部门、职位等),决定用户是否有权限访问数据。通过定义不同的属性和访问控制规则,可以为不同类型的用户和应用程序实现细粒度的数据访问控制。

基于策略的访问控制(PBAC)

制定访问策略,根据策略决定用户是否有权限访问数据。通过定义不同的策略和访问控制规则,可以为不同类型的用户和应用程序实现细粒度的数据访问控制。

数据标记和分类

对数据进行标记和分类,根据数据敏感程度和用户权限,实现细粒度的数据访问控制。通过定义不同的标记和分类规则,可以为不同类型的用户和应用程序实现细粒度的数据访问控制。

数据加密和脱敏

对敏感数据进行加密和脱敏处理,只有授权用户才能解密或查看数据。通过定义不同的加密和脱敏策略,可以为不同类型的用户和应用程序实现细粒度的数据访问控制。

相关文章
[C#]实现任何数据库类型的DbHelper帮助类 使用C#创建SQLite控制台应用程序
我们可以看到,在此类中,有很多用于创建数据库相关对象的类型,如DbConnection,DbCommand,DbDataAdapter等。
CNXY
2019-05-24
4.1K0
网络安全架构|零信任网络安全当前趋势(上)
本文介绍ACT-IAC(美国技术委员会-工业咨询委员会)于2019年4月18日发布的《零信任网络安全当前趋势》(《Zero Trust Cybersecurity Current Trends》)报告的主要内容。
网络安全观
2021-02-26
6930
裸机云服务优缺点
裸机云计算服务综合了物理服务器和公共云两者的优点,但是这可能并不适用于所有的工作负载。用户在做出决定之前应权衡利弊。 在某些情况下,公共云服务无法为管理员提供全面的可见性和控制权,特别是在可变工作负载
静一
2018-03-27
4K0
如何为 Kubernetes 构建合适的平台
本文翻译自 How to Build The Right Platform for Kubernetes 。
云云众生s
2024-03-27
940
基于Apache Parquet™的更细粒度的加密方法
数据访问限制、保留和静态加密是基本的安全控制。 本博客介绍了uber如何构建和利用开源 Apache Parquet™ 的细粒度加密功能以统一的方式支持所有 3 个控件。 特别是,我们将重点关注以安全、可靠和高效的方式设计和应用加密的技术挑战。 本文还将分享uber在生产和大规模管理系统的推荐实践方面的经验。
从大数据到人工智能
2022-03-22
1.9K0
点击加载更多
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档
领券